Business Success in Dubai: The Importance of Systems Over Speed

Date:

Dubai has always been a fast-paced business hub, where new opportunities and ventures flourish rapidly. For many years, the ability to adapt quickly and seize opportunities was synonymous with success in this dynamic environment. However, as the landscape matures, a different story emerges. Organizations that grow swiftly without a clear structure often find it difficult to maintain performance, while those that take the time to invest in robust systems tend to endure the test of time.

This evolution reflects a significant shift in how success is gauged. Mere expansion is no longer the sole indicator of strength. Today, qualities like stability, predictability, and disciplined execution hold equal weight in defining a successful enterprise.

When Speed Stops Being an Advantage

In the initial growth phases, rapid decision-making is often effective. Smaller teams enable direct communication, which allows leaders to maintain a clear view of daily operations. Under these conditions, informal coordination may seem efficient. However, as organizations scale, this approach begins to falter. New hires may interpret tasks differently, and distinct departmental routines emerge. Consequently, decision-making often becomes more about individual judgment than a unified approach, leading to inconsistencies over time.

In the competitive realm of Dubai, these discrepancies quickly become evident. Customers may notice uneven service levels, while partners experience delays. Leadership often finds itself preoccupied with mitigating issues rather than steering strategic direction. The once prized speed can shift from being an advantage to becoming a source of instability.

Why Informal Execution Breaks at Scale

Many rapidly growing organizations lean on the expertise of a few seasoned individuals to uphold control. As long as these key players remain, results are steady. However, when they depart, performance tends to wane. This reliance poses significant risks, as critical knowledge is often retained by individuals rather than embedded in processes. This lack of formal training channels leads to recurring mistakes due to missed lessons learned.

As businesses grow, depending solely on personal expertise becomes increasingly unfeasible. Systems must bear the weight of operations. In the absence of structured systems, growth can amplify existing vulnerabilities instead of bolstering strengths.
